History For several years Eddie McGuire, an amateur Magic illusion magician had been in correspondence with some of the top names, notably T. Nelson Downs in New York . He spoke often of his association with an amazing card cheat, Walter Scott, and his unbelievable skills at the cardtable. In New York, on 14 June 1930, McGuire arranged a special presentation to the Inner Circle of the New York magic elite. Scott wowed his audience and became an overnight sensation. Table A in UK company law is the old name for to the Model Articles or default form of Articles of Association law articles of association for private limited company by shares companies limited by shares incorporated either in England and Wales or in Scotland before 1 October 2009 where the incorporators do not explicitly choose to use a modified form. Table A was first introduced by the Joint Stock Companies Act 1856 as Table B , and then under its current name of Table A by the Companies Act 1862 . unreferenced date March 2012 Comment cards are a mechanism used to attract feedback for restaurants, hotels, and other businesses in the hospitality industry. Comment cards tend to feature a brief form where the patron can enter information about their experience at the establishment. The information entered is used to improve the facility, service, or product. They are typically printed on heavy cardstock. Some are meant to be folded and mailed, though in most establishments it is proper to leave the card on a table or include it in the guest check presentation book. Not all comment cards involve a form. Many typically will simply list the establishment s owner s name and a business address where letters may be addressed, and perhaps a phone number, email address, or website. The card serves as a table of contents for the mission and a quick ...A dance card or programme du bal also known by its German language German language name, Tanzkarte is used by a woman to record the names of the gentlemen with whom she intends to dance each successive dance at a formal ballroom dancing ball . They appear to have originated in 18th century, but their use first became widespread in 19th century Vienna , especially at the massive balls during Fasching before Lent . No footnotes date March 2010 mergeTo Business card date November 2011 Image VisitingCardJohannVanBeethoven.jpg thumb Visiting card of Johann van Beethoven, brother of Ludwig van Beethoven A visiting card , also known as a calling card , is a small paper card with one s name printed on it. They first appeared in China in the 15th century Citation needed date December 2011 , and in Europe in the 17th century. Image POST card 3usd.jpg BIOS POST card for PCI bus. thumb right In computing , a POST card is a plug in Expansion card interface card that displays progress and error codes generated during power on self test POST of a computer. It is used to troubleshoot computers that do not Booting start up . Working principle If at least the CPU, BIOS, and the I O interface the POST card relies on are working, the system sends two hexadecimal digit codes to a specified I O port usually 80  hex during startup, some indicating a stage in the startup procedure, others identifying errors. The description for each code must be looked up in a table for the particular BIOS. For example, for the 1984 IBM PC AT code 1D is issued when about to Determine Memory Size Above 1024K , and code 2D in the event of 8042 Keyboard Controller Failure, 105 System Error . If startup does not complete successfully, either an error code, or the code of the last operation, is available. POST cards provide information even when a standard display is not available, either because connecting a monitor is impractical, or because the failure occurs before the video subsystem is operational. Card Player magazine is an industry publication and web portal specializing in poker media, poker strategy and poker tournament coverage. The magazine was founded in 1988 by June Field. In 1998 it was bought by Barry Shulman , ref cite news first Jim last Ruymen coauthors title Poker s growing stakes date 2004 07 26 publisher MSNBC.com url http www.msnbc.msn.com id 4694939 work Reuters pages accessdate 2008 11 23 language ref who is the current publisher and CEO. Jeff Shulman is the President. ref cite news first Walter last Kirn coauthors Jeffrey Ressner title Poker s New Face date 2004 07 26 publisher url http www.time.com time magazine article 0,9171,994714 1,00.html work Time Magazine pages accessdate 2008 11 23 language ref The publication s umbrella company, Card Player Media, LLC, also publishes Card Player Europe . The magazines have a combined monthly circulation of approximately 300,000. Card Player releases a new issue every two weeks.
